If the deposits are seriously undesirable, wash The within of your tub with an answer of household ammonia and delicate detergent. Rinse totally and wipe the tub with liquid bleach. A word of caution: Rinse the tub thoroughly before wiping it out with bleach. The mix of ammonia and bleach forms a potentially harmful gasoline known as chloramine. This compound could potentially cause health concerns ranging from mild pores and skin irritation to digestive and kidney troubles [supply: CCAC]

Identify the drain hose in the back of your washer. If your hose is crushed or kinked, straighten it out to allow water to movement via freely. To check for clogs within the hose or drainpipe, consult your model’s Use and Care Guide for instructions on how to remove the hose with the device.
